The Art Institute of Chicago is one of the most prestigious and renowned museums in the world. Located in the heart of Chicago, the museum is home to a vast collection of art and artifacts from around the globe. Founded in 1879, the museum has grown to become one of the largest and most comprehensive art museums in the world, with over 300,000 works of art in its collection.
The museum’s collection spans a wide range of art and artifacts, from ancient Egyptian artifacts to contemporary paintings and sculptures. The museum also has a large collection of American art, including works by Grant Wood, Edward Hopper, and Georgia O’Keeffe. The museum’s collection of Impressionist and Post-Impressionist paintings is particularly impressive, with works by Monet, Renoir, Van Gogh, and Gauguin.
One of the museum’s most famous works is Grant Wood’s American Gothic, which is on display in the museum’s American Art collection. The painting depicts a farmer and his daughter standing in front of their house, and has become an iconic image of American life.
In addition to its permanent collection, the museum also hosts a wide range of temporary exhibitions throughout the year. Recent exhibitions have included shows on the works of Pablo Picasso, Vincent Van Gogh, and Frida Kahlo.
The Art Institute of Chicago is also home to a world-class research library, which contains over 250,000 volumes of art-related books, journals, and periodicals. The library is open to the public, and is a valuable resource for scholars and students of art history.
Visitors to the museum can also enjoy a variety of dining options, including the museum’s own restaurant, Terzo Piano, which offers stunning views of Millennium Park and Lake Michigan.
